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
69 827316 5464054
648 511965633
648 511965633
04 05319369046 407371 50
All about undefined
Interested in learning more?
648 511965633
04 05319369046 407371 50
See more
171 0871460
38266 75835 6324471249
See more
102945 87577623
18630 09 3643534 96744 192
See more